I check the > contents of the Ansible provisioned /home/vagrant/.ssh/authorized_keys in > the last clean.sh and it looks okay to me there but perhaps I'm missing > something? > > Thanks, > Kevin > > > On Tue, Nov 15, 2016 at 12:27 AM, Rickard von Essen <[email protected] > <javascript:>> wrote: > >> Could you attach your template and scripts or link to a repo with them >> in? >> >> On Nov 15, 2016 01:02, "Kevin Clarke" <[email protected] <javascript:>> >> wrote: >> >>> Hi, >>> >>> I have a Packer (v. 0.11.0) build that outputs a VirtualBox (v. >>> 5.0.24_Ubuntu >>> r108355) VM that I then want Packer to make Vagrant (v 1.8.7) friendly. >>> I have my Vagrant post-processor configured to leave the VirtualBox working >>> files: >>> >>> "post-processors": [ >>> { >>> "output": "builds/{{.Provider}}-centos6.box", >>> "type": "vagrant", >>> "keep_input_artifact": true >>> } >>> ] >>> >>> I'm wanting to use the insecure SSH key but when I try to `vagrant up` >>> on the finished product the key authentication fails. Looking at the >>> ~/.ssh/authorized_keys files I see they are different between the vmdk >>> that's bundled up in the final .box versus the vmdk working file. The >>> working files vmdk's authorized_keys file has the public key that I've >>> downloaded and configured as a part of my provisioning, but after the >>> Vagrant post-processor runs, the key in authorized_keys has been changed. >>> I've tried setting the config.ssh.private_key_path in my Vagrantfile to my >>> personal private key and the private key >>> at ~/.vagrant.d/insecure_private_key but neither seems to correspond to key >>> in the vagrant output (or at least I get an authentication failure when I >>> try to vagrant up). >>> >>> I want to use the insecure SSH in the vagrant box but I don't see an >>> option in the vagrant post-processor to not do whatever it's doing to >>> rewrite the value in the authorized_keys file. Any tips? >>> >>> Thanks, >>> Kevin >>> >>> -- >>> This mailing list is governed under the HashiCorp Community Guidelines - >>> https://www.hashicorp.com/community-guidelines.html.
